Transmission problem
1997 Nissan Maxima Engine Size unknown Front Wheel Drive Automatic 118000 miles
----------------------------------------------------------------
hi, i got a problem with my transmission. i drove from san diego to covina with no problems at all. but the next day, when i was suppose to move the car for the first time that day, the transmission wont change from "P" to other position. i checkout the brakes and the stoplight and its working just fine. is there a minor troubleshooting to determine the real problem?

Try moving the steering wheel to its extreme left and right and at the same be turning the key

You have a problem with the shift interlock system-get the shift lock solenoid and the computer with it check out. You should have an override button-
